What to Look For in Dental Hygienist License Programs in Rhode Island
When choosing a Dental Hygienist License training program, consider accreditation status, program length, cost, and the amount of clinical hours provided. Examining the pass rates of former students on licensure exams also offers insight into program effectiveness.

Frequently Asked Questions
How much does Dental Hygienist License training cost in Rhode Island?
Costs vary by program and can range broadly depending on the institution and length of the program. Financial aid may be available.
How long does it take to get Dental Hygienist License certified in Rhode Island?
Most programs take about two years to complete, leading to an associate degree which is required for licensure.
What are the requirements for Dental Hygienist License training in Rhode Island?
Requirements include a high school diploma or GED, completion of an accredited dental hygiene program, and passing national and state exams.
Are there online Dental Hygienist License programs in Rhode Island?
Yes, there are hybrid programs that offer both online coursework and in-person clinical practice, though complete online programs are rare.
What is the job outlook for Dental Hygienist License holders in Rhode Island?
The job outlook is positive, with an expected growth in dental hygiene jobs due to increasing demand for dental care.
Is financial aid available for Dental Hygienist License programs in Rhode Island?
Yes, financial aid is available through various sources including federal grants, loans, and scholarships specific to dental hygiene students.
What should I look for in a Dental Hygienist License training program?
Key factors include accreditation by the Commission on Dental Accreditation, program length, cost, clinical hours, and pass rates of graduates on licensure exams.
How do I choose between Dental Hygienist License programs in Rhode Island?
Consider program accreditation, costs, duration, proximity to your location, clinical training opportunities, and success rates of graduates on national and state licensure exams.
